    Pred definitely makes for short-tempers. Also rapidly changing moods--snap at someone, then cry, then depression, then more anger. Short-term memory loss is also a famous side effect of pred. It also happens with chronic illness.

    A neuropsychiatrist at JHU once explained to me how the brain chemicals get depleted with chronic illness. At the time I was experiencing cognitive issues (eg memory loss, difficulty finding words) and thought I had a brain disorder. It was "just" Wegs, depression and the residual effects of pred.

    Okay, I resumed a pred taper last week and made it from 4mg down to 3.5mg. I spent several days at 3.75mg, making sure nothing new cropped up. I also increased some anti-inflammatory and anti-oxidant supplements that don't interfere with my meds or their immunosuppressive actions. So far so good. Until I increased them, I was getting joint pain and stiffness as I tapered pred.

    Friday I really overexerted--not much choice, unfortunately-- and spent most of yesterday in bed. I'm still low today, but will be conserving energy as best as I can.
